🌹 Kalaat M’Gouna – The Valley of Roses

Where fragrant blooms, Berber traditions, and Atlas mountains create a magical escape

Kalaat M’Gouna, often called the city of roses, is one of Morocco’s most enchanting destinations. Nestled between the rugged High Atlas Mountains and the lush valleys of the Dadès region, this charming town is famous for its endless rose fields, traditional Amazigh culture, and warm hospitality.

Every spring, millions of Damask roses bloom across the valley, turning it into a sea of pink petals — a symbol of beauty, celebration, and community.

🗺️ Top Highlights

🌹 The Rose Valley (Vallée des Roses)

Stretching along the M’Goun River, the valley is home to endless rose bushes cultivated for perfumes, beauty products, and traditional distillation. Walking or biking through the villages is one of the most peaceful experiences in Morocco.

🌺 The Annual Rose Festival

Held every May, this colorful event celebrates the rose harvest with:

  • Traditional dances

  • Music performances

  • Markets and local crafts

  • A rose queen ceremony

  • Parades and village gatherings

It’s one of Morocco’s most unique cultural festivals.

🏰 Kasbahs & Berber Villages

The area is dotted with old kasbahs and fortified homes, including Aït Youl and other Amazigh villages. These villages offer a window into rural life, handmade crafts, and traditions preserved for centuries.

⛰️ Valley of M’Goun (Atlas Mountains)

Outdoor lovers can explore:

  • Scenic mountain trails

  • Panoramic viewpoints

  • Hiking routes to the M’Goun summit (the second-highest peak in Morocco)

🧴 Visit Rose Cooperatives

Learn how natural rose water and oils are produced using traditional distillation methods. Many cooperatives sell organic products directly from the valley.

🍽️ Local Cuisine

The region is known for simple, hearty Amazigh dishes:

  • Tagine with mountain herbs

  • Berber couscous

  • Fresh goat cheese

  • Rose-flavored pastries

  • Mint tea with rose water

Meals are often homemade and served with genuine Amazigh hospitality.
